在当今信息时代,个人网站已成为展示个人品牌、分享兴趣爱好和创作作品的重要工具。创建一个简单的个人网页,不需要复杂的技术背景和高深的编程知识。本文将介绍如何从头开始设计一个简单的个人网页,并提供相应的代码示例,帮助您轻松实现这一目标。
一、准备工作
在构建个人网页之前,您需要准备一些基本的信息和资源。首先,想好您希望在网站上展示的内容,比如:
- 个人简介
- 作品展示
- 联系方式
- 兴趣爱好
您需要一个代码编辑器(如VS Code或Sublime Text)以及一个浏览器来查看和测试您的网页。
二、基础HTML结构
网页的基础是HTML(超文本标记语言)。以下是一个简单的HTML结构示例,可以作为您的个人网页的起点:
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>我的个人网页</title>
<link rel="stylesheet" href="styles.css">
</head>
<body>
<header>
<h1>欢迎来到我的个人网页</h1>
<nav>
<ul>
<li><a href="#about">关于我</a></li>
<li><a href="#portfolio">作品集</a></li>
<li><a href="#contact">联系方式</a></li>
</ul>
</nav>
</header>
<main>
<section id="about">
<h2>关于我</h2>
<p>这是我的个人简介。在这里,您可以了解我的背景和技能。</p>
</section>
<section id="portfolio">
<h2>作品集</h2>
<p>这是我过去的一些项目作品。</p>
</section>
<section id="contact">
<h2>联系方式</h2>
<p>如果您想和我联系,请发送邮件至<em>example@example.com</em>。</p>
</section>
</main>
<footer>
<p>© 2023 我的个人网页</p>
</footer>
</body>
</html>
以上代码提供了一个简单的个人网页框架,包括网页标题、导航栏、几个内容区域及页脚。通过这样的结构,可以清晰地展示您的个人信息。
三、增加CSS样式
为了让您简单的网页看起来更加美观,我们需要添加一些CSS(层叠样式表)。在上面的HTML代码中,我们引入了一个styles.css
文件,下面是一个简单的CSS样式示例:
body {
font-family: Arial, sans-serif;
margin: 0;
padding: 0;
background-color: #f4f4f4;
}
header {
background: #35424a;
color: #ffffff;
padding: 20px 0;
text-align: center;
}
nav ul {
list-style: none;
padding: 0;
}
nav ul li {
display: inline;
margin: 0 15px;
}
nav ul li a {
color: #ffffff;
text-decoration: none;
}
h1, h2 {
margin: 0;
}
section {
padding: 20px;
margin: 20px 0;
background: #ffffff;
border-radius: 5px;
}
footer {
text-align: center;
padding: 10px 0;
background: #35424a;
color: #ffffff;
}
通过这些样式,网页将会有一个清晰的布局和现代的视觉风格。重要的是,CSS能够改善用户体验,让访问者更容易浏览您分享的内容。
四、优化内容和SEO设置
在创建完基础网页后,如何进行SEO(搜索引擎优化)是提升个人网页可见性的关键。以下是几个技巧:
关键词优化:在文章和内容中自然地融入与您相关的关键词,比如“个人网站设计”、“个人作品集”等。这样有助于搜索引擎在用户搜索时更容易找到您的网页。
使用meta标签:在页面的
<head>
部分添加描述信息和关键词。例如:
<meta name="description" content="这是我的个人网页,展示我的兴趣、作品和联系方式。">
<meta name="keywords" content="个人网页, 网页设计, 作品集">
提高页面加载速度:优化图片大小,使用轻量级的CSS和JS文件,从而提升网页加载速度,改善用户体验。
响应式设计:确保您的网页在不同设备上(如手机、平板和电脑)都能良好显示。这可以通过CSS的媒体查询实现。
@media (max-width: 600px) {
nav ul li {
display: block;
margin: 10px 0;
}
}
五、添加交互功能
尽管一个简单的个人网页可以有效地展示信息,但增加一些互动功能可以提升用户体验。您可以考虑以下正文:
- 联系表单:利用HTML和JavaScript创建一个简单的联系表单,让访客更方便地与您联系。
<section id="contact">
<h2>联系方式</h2>
<form>
<label for="name">姓名:</label>
<input type="text" id="name" name="name" required>
<label for="email">邮箱:</label>
<input type="email" id="email" name="email" required>
<label for="message">留言:</label>
<textarea id="message" name="message" required></textarea>
<button type="submit">发送</button>
</form>
</section>
- 社交媒体链接:在网页上添加自己的社交媒体链接,让访客更方便找到您在其他平台上的信息。
通过以上步骤,您将能够创建一个既简单又功能齐全的个人网页。只要具备基本的HTML和CSS知识,您就可以轻松实现自己的需求。这样的个人站点不仅能帮助您展示自己,还能为您在网络世界赢得一席之地。